About The Position

Gratiot Integrated Health Network (GIHN) has an immediate opening for a full-time Peer Support and Recovery Specialist. The Peer Support and Recovery Specialist is responsible for co-facilitating the person-centered planning process and assisting with services and support in the broader community, under the supervision of the Community Supports Program Supervisor. Peer Recovery trained staff must be in active recovery for a minimum of two years, sought treatment from a Community Mental Health Agency and have developed the skills required to utilize what they have learned from their own recovery to help GIHN consumers move toward their own recovery. Requirements

  • Must possess a high school diploma or GED.
  • Must be an individual in a journey of recovery who has a serious mental illness who is now receiving or has received services from the public mental health system. [This is a requirement for any Peer Support Specialist certified after July 1, 2011.] Because of their life experience, they provide expertise that professional disciplines cannot replicate.
  • Individuals employed as Peer Support Specialists serving beneficiaries with mental illness must meet MDHHS specialized training and certification requirements.
  • Peer Support Specialists who assist in the provision of a covered service must be trained and supervised by the qualified provider of that service.
  • Peer Support Specialists who provide covered services without supervision must meet the specific provider qualifications.
